Nous sommes à la recherche d’un développeur Java senior, disponible en freelance, pour rejoindre notre équipe d’intégration PFM (Processus Financiers Modernes). Le candidat idéal possède une solide expérience en Java (JDK 11+), Spring Boot, Spring Cloud, et une connaissance approfondie des architectures microservices. Il doit également maîtriser les bases de données relationnelles (PostgreSQL, MySQL) ainsi que les systèmes de cache (Redis, Memcached) et les outils de gestion de configuration (Docker, Kubernetes).
Responsabilités principales :
- Concevoir, développer et maintenir des services backend robustes et évolutifs.
- Collaborer étroitement avec les équipes d’intégration, de QA et de DevOps pour assurer la qualité et la rapidité de livraison.
- Participer à la rédaction de la documentation technique et aux revues de code.
- Assurer la performance, la sécurité et la conformité des applications.
Profil recherché :
- Expérience confirmée (minimum 5 ans) en développement Java.
- Maîtrise des frameworks Spring (Boot, Cloud, Data).
- Connaissance des principes SOLID, DDD et des bonnes pratiques de CI/CD.
- Capacité à travailler de manière autonome tout en restant intégré dans une équipe multidisciplinaire.
- Excellente communication en français et en anglais.
Nous offrons :
- Un contrat freelance flexible, avec rémunération compétitive (à négocier selon expérience).
- Possibilité de travail hybride (présentiel à Casablanca ou Rabat, et télétravail).
- Accès à des projets innovants dans le secteur financier.
- Environnement de travail stimulant, avec des outils modernes et une culture d’apprentissage continu.
Si vous êtes passionné par les technologies financières et que vous souhaitez contribuer à des projets de grande envergure tout en bénéficiant d’une flexibilité optimale, nous serions ravis de recevoir votre candidature. Veuillez nous contacter via le formulaire de candidature sur notre site ou par téléphone pour plus d’informations.